​​Joel Blanco is an artist, designer, researcher and consultant specialising in future scenarios, speculative design and design fiction. Joel is joining Medialab as faculty of the 4th LAB program, titled Weird Futures (read the White Paper to find out more). We asked Joel to respond to the topics we would like to touch upon in the LAB 4 as a starting point for the creative and critical research that we would like to carry out this year, particularly during the Collaborative Prototyping Lab, which is to be held in November 2025 at Medialab Matadero. The result is a twofold contribution: the first one is a short webinar, realized in conversation with Medialab's curator Bani Brusadin, where Joel discusses some seminal ideas about unexpected alignments between bodies, images and infrastructures in contemporary male online subcultures connected to the resurgence of long-gone political fantasies. A short and visionary text entitled MANDIBULA, follows, which can be read as some semi-fictional, portable manifesto to guide Joel's research and contribution to LAB 4 Weird Futures

The webinar and the text have been commissioned by Medialab in May 2025.
